ABSTRACT:
An optical disk is equipped with a hub which is very easy to attach and detach. The hub has a bottom and a cylindrical wall which projects upwards from the bottom, and which is inserted in the center hole of the optical disk. The cylindrical wall of the hub is slotted so that the upper end of the cylindrical wall can be bent radially inwards to a smaller diameter allowing removal of the hub from the optical disk. The hub further has stoppers, formed at or near the bottom, for abutting the lower surface of the optical disk, and claws formed at or near the upper end of the cylindrical wall, for abutting on the upper surface of the optical disk.
